DEV Community

KlearStack
KlearStack

Posted on

Extract Data from ID Cards with Greater Accuracy and Speed

The need for secure and accurate identity verification has never been higher. According to a 2024 study by Juniper Research, digital identity verification checks are expected to exceed 70 billion annually by 2026. This increase is driven by rising compliance requirements, remote onboarding, and fraud prevention demands across sectors like banking, logistics, and insurance.

  • How much time does your team lose in manual ID verification?
  • What happens when human error creeps into your compliance process?
  • Could your current system handle an unexpected surge in verification requests?

These questions highlight why organizations are moving toward automated solutions that can handle large volumes of ID data in seconds. This post explains how to Extract Data from ID Cards using intelligent technology while keeping accuracy, compliance, and operational efficiency in focus.

What Does It Mean to Extract Data from ID Cards

Extracting data from ID cards involves converting printed or embedded information on physical or digital cards into usable, structured data. This process can handle fields such as names, dates of birth, addresses, card numbers, and expiry dates.

The challenge is to complete this process accurately while ensuring the data is compliant with industry regulations like KYC (Know Your Customer) and GDPR. Businesses in banking, shipping, and BFSI require ID verification at scale, making automation a necessity rather than an option.

Modern solutions use optical character recognition (OCR) along with artificial intelligence to identify and extract key fields while avoiding duplication or misreads.

How Intelligent Data Extraction Improves ID Verification

Intelligent data extraction uses AI-driven algorithms to understand, process, and verify identity documents far beyond simple OCR capabilities. It not only reads text but also interprets layouts, validates patterns, and flags inconsistencies.

Higher Accuracy Rates

Advanced AI models can reach accuracy levels above 99% by cross-referencing extracted data against preset templates or national ID standards.

Faster Processing Time

Manual data entry might take several minutes per card. Automated systems can process hundreds of IDs per minute without sacrificing precision.

Reduced Fraud Risk

By integrating with verification APIs, intelligent data extraction can instantly flag forged or altered documents, preventing fraudulent transactions before they progress.

The result is a scalable, secure process that helps companies manage compliance while improving customer onboarding speed.

Key Technologies Used in ID Card Data Extraction

Optical Character Recognition (OCR)
OCR converts printed characters on IDs into machine-readable text. This is the foundation of most automated ID verification systems.

Computer Vision

Computer vision detects card edges, orientation, and alignment to ensure accurate capture before data extraction begins.

Machine Learning Models

ML models learn from thousands of ID formats, enabling the system to adapt to new card types and layouts without manual reconfiguration.

When these technologies work together, the outcome is a system that adapts to multiple document types with minimal setup.

Industry Use Cases for Automated ID Data Extraction

Banking and Financial Services

Banks use ID data extraction for KYC compliance, account openings, and loan approvals. Automation reduces the turnaround time from days to minutes.

Logistics and Shipping

Courier and freight companies verify sender and receiver identities before goods are dispatched, reducing fraud in high-value shipments.

Insurance

Insurers verify identities during policy issuance and claims processing, lowering the risk of fraudulent claims.

These applications show that Extract Data from ID Cards is not just about speed, but also about security and compliance.

Implementation Best Practices

Maintain Compliance with Regulations

Any ID data extraction process must follow local and international regulations to avoid penalties and reputational damage.

Integrate with Existing Systems

Linking extraction software with your CRM or ERP helps avoid data silos and improves operational visibility.

Conduct Regular Accuracy Audits

Set periodic checks to validate the accuracy of the extracted data, ensuring your system continues to perform as expected.

Automation is most effective when combined with clear compliance policies and periodic performance reviews.

Conclusion

Automating ID card data extraction is now essential for industries where security and compliance are top priorities. Solutions that combine OCR, AI, and machine learning deliver faster processing, improved accuracy, and better fraud prevention outcomes.

Key takeaways for businesses:

  • Faster onboarding without sacrificing verification quality
  • Reduced operational costs through automation
  • Stronger fraud prevention with AI-driven checks

Easier integration with compliance workflows

For organizations ready to improve their verification processes, adopting solutions that can Extract Data from ID Cards using intelligent data extraction is the next logical step.

FAQs

Q1. How accurate is automated ID card data extraction?

Modern AI-based systems can achieve accuracy rates above 99% when properly configured.

Q2. Can these systems handle non-standard ID formats?

Yes, machine learning models adapt to new layouts and formats over time.

Q3. Is the process secure?

Yes, leading solutions use encryption and follow compliance standards like GDPR and KYC.

Q4. Can it be integrated with my CRM?

Yes, most enterprise-grade solutions offer API integrations with CRMs, ERPs, and verification tools.

Top comments (0)